Know exactly who meets your standardsâand who doesnât
Visitor Assessments are digital questionnaires or training modules that guests must complete before entering your workplace. They can take many forms depending on your needs.Â
Here are a few examples:
- A quick acknowledgment of a fire safety policy
- A short quiz confirming lab safety knowledge
- A video walkthrough of emergency procedures followed by questions
- A detailed compliance check for regulations such as ITAR, EAR, or GDPR
Think of assessments as your built-in safety net. They confirm that visitors understand your policies, meet regulatory standards, and are ready to be onsite. And since they automatically store results, you always have a clear record of who passed, when they completed their training, and whether the assessment was up to dateâensuring your team stays audit ready.
Tailor and manage assessments with ease
Now that you know what assessments are, letâs dig into some of the features weâve designed that make them work for you: customization, flexible controls, and assignment at scale.
Customizable design
Every workplace has unique compliance and safety needs, so weâve made it simple to build assessments that fit yours. You can organize assessments into sections, add helpful context with descriptions, embed PDFs or training videos, and include questions to confirm knowledge.Â
The format and flow are completely up to you.
Flexible compliance controls
Since compliance isnât a one-time task, weâve built Visitor Assessments with flexible controls to keep your standards current. Here are three ways you can stay in control:
- Require guests to answer every question correctly before entry
- Set custom validity periods so retakes happen on the schedule you choose
- Use version control to automatically prompt a retake whenever updates are made
This way, your assessments always reflect the latest standards, and you can be confident your records stay accurate and reliable.
Management at scale
Whether you manage one workplace or 50, assessments scale with you. Assign them to specific sign-in flows, apply them by location, or roll them out globally with Global Visitor Assessments. No matter the setup, youâll know visitors are meeting the right standards everywhere they sign in.
Fit assessments seamlessly into the visitor journey
Once your assessments are built, the next step is making sure every visitor completes them without slowing down the sign-in process. No two visits look the same, which is why assessments meet guests wherever they are in the sign-in flow:
- Preregistration. Visitors can complete assessments before they arrive, saving time at the front desk and reducing bottlenecks.
- Kiosk. Walk-ins are prompted to pass their assessment on the kiosk before a badge is printed, so no one enters without clearing requirements.
- Static QR code. Guests can scan a code and complete the assessment on their own device, giving them flexibility and keeping your check-in line moving.
Every option ensures the same outcome: visitors pass the right assessment before stepping inside. That consistency makes it easier to enforce policies across entry points while keeping the process smooth for both guests and admins. A win-win.Â
Give admins visibility & keep compliance records airtight
The final piece of the puzzle is making compliance easy to track on the backend. Assessments give your team peace of mind that checks are happeningâand the ability to prove it.Â
Admins can quickly see pass/fail status in visitor logs, track compliance across locations, and pull centralized reports for audits. If your organization is subject to regulations such as ITAR or EAR, this visibility makes audits faster and less stressful.
